How can companies effectively measure the impact of virtual reality and augmented reality on customer satisfaction and loyalty in remote customer experience rituals, and what strategies can be implemented to continuously improve the overall experience?
Companies can measure the impact of virtual reality and augmented reality on customer satisfaction and loyalty by collecting feedback from customers through surveys, interviews, and analytics. They can also track key performance indicators such as engagement levels, repeat purchases, and customer retention rates. To continuously improve the overall experience, companies can invest in regular updates and enhancements to their virtual reality and augmented reality technology, provide personalized and interactive experiences, and offer incentives for customers to engage with the technology. Additionally, companies can leverage data analytics to identify pain points and areas for improvement in the customer experience.
